About Hossein Nasiri
Hossein Nasiri is a scholar working on Management, Monitoring, Policy and Law, Environmental Engineering and Internal Medicine, having authored 21 papers that have together received 332 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Soil and Land Suitability Analysis (8 papers), Groundwater and Watershed Analysis (3 papers) and Health and Well-being Studies (2 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Management Science and Operations Research (87 citations), Management, Monitoring, Policy and Law (67 citations) and Environmental Engineering (71 citations). Hossein Nasiri has collaborated with scholars based in Iran, Malaysia and Italy. Frequent co-authors include Hamid Reza Jafari, Ali Azizi, Bahram Malekmohammadi, Vahid Amini Parsa, H A Faraji Sabokbar, Ali Darvishi Boloorani, Gwo‐Hshiung Tzeng, Pourahmad Ahmad, Audrius Banaitis and Ali Hosseini. Their work appears in journals such as SHILAP Revista de lepidopterología, Environmental Monitoring and Assessment and Technological and Economic Development of Economy.
